The Architecture of Modern Chat Systems
Modern AI models are not just repositories of information. They use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G), which lets a system base its answers on real-time data or specific documents, such as those on Microsoft SharePoint. Key technical components include:
Multimodality: Systems can process and create text, images, audio, and video at the same time, as seen in the "omnimodel" abilities of ChatGPT-4o.
Reduced Latency: Real-time voice interaction engines, like those from Agora, have reduced response times to under a second, making conversations feel natural.
Agentic Frameworks: Tools like ChatDev simulate virtual organizations where multiple AI agents work together on complex tasks like software development. Practical Applications and Business Integration

If you are building a chat-based application (like a "version 65" update), here are the core pillars to focus on: 1. Technical Development & Infrastructure
Agent Communication: For advanced systems, use frameworks like ChatDev to allow multiple AI agents (CEO, CTO, Programmer) to collaborate on tasks.
UI/UX Customization: Implement features like markdown message rendering, file attachments, and prompt suggestions using tools like the DevExpress AI Chat Control.
Inference Engines: Use high-performance engines like vLLM for fast model serving and chat responses. 2. Features for User Retention
Proactive Chat: Set up widgets that initiate conversations based on user behavior.
Real-time Metrics: Display average wait times or queue positions to manage user expectations.
